امروزه، کامپیوترها و روش های عددی جایگزینی برای محاسبات پیچیده را فراهم می کنند. با استفاده از قدرت کامپیوتر برای به دست آوردن راه حل به طور مستقیم، می توان این محاسبات را بدون توسل به فرضیات ساده و یا تکنیک های زمان بر آن انجام داد. اگر چه راهحل های تحلیلی برای حل مسأله هنوز هم بسیار با ارزش بوده و فراهم آورنده بینش هستند، روش های عددی جایگزینی را ارائه می دهد، که توانایی ها را برای رویارویی و حل مسائل توسعه می دهد. در نتیجه، زمان بیشتری برای استفاده از مهارت های خلاق در دسترس است.
معرفی نرم افزار
نرمافزار maple یا سامانه رایانهای جبری میپل یکی از نرمافزارهای مشهور ریاضی است.
این نرم افزار محصول شرکت Maplesoft است که در زمرهی نرمافزارهای CAS مخفف Computer Algebra System و بهمعنی سامانهی رایانهای جبری و یا جبر محاسباتی قرار میگیرد. Maple به معنی درخت افرا است که تصویر آن در پرچم کانادا؛ کشور محل تولید اولین نسخهی میپل در دانشگاه Waterloo وجود دارد. برخورداری از زبان برنامهنویسی ترکیبی و پویا، انجام انواع عملیات و محاسبات پیچیدهی ریاضی، رسم توابع و نمودارهای مختلف، تجزیه، تحلیل و تجسم مسائل ریاضیات، بههمراه راهنمای جامع نرمافزار برخی از قابلیتها و خصوصیات این برنامه است.
کاربرد میپل در پروژه های صنعتی. یکی از اهداف مهم صنایع مختلف کاهش هزینه تولید و افزایش کیفیت محصولات است که امروزه شبیه سازی فرایند تولید با استفاده از نرم افزارهای مدل ساز ریاضی بسیار مرسوم شده است. در این بین نرم افزار میپل نیازهای محاسباتی صنایع را به شکل مطلوبی برآورده ساخته است.
امروزه بیشتر الگوریتمها توسط رایانه اجرا میشوند نرم افزارهایی برای اجرای محاسبات ریاضی طراحی شده اند. از مهمترین و کاربردیترین آنها میتوان به نرم افزارهایی زیر اشاره کرد:
- Scilab
- Maple
- Mathematica
- GNU Octave
- Matlab
- زبان برنامهنویسی IDL
- زبان برنامهنویسی R
Maple یک مفسر، برای زبان برنامه نویسی پویا است، به طور معمول، عبارات جبری و عبارات منطقی در حافظه کامپیوتر، ذخیره می شوند و پس از آن بوسیله این نرم افزار پردازش شده و حل میگردند. از این نرم افزار در حل مسایل مختلف ریاضی از قبیل هندسه، حساب و ... استفاده می شود.
وقتی Maple اجرا می گردد فقط هسته که پایه و اساس سیستم Maple و شامل دستورات بنیادی و اولیه می باشد را به حافظه منتقل می کند. هسته از کدهایی به زبان C تشکیل شده که تقریبا ۱۰ درصد کل سیستم Maple را در بر می گیرد. به منظور سرعت و کارایی بیشتر هسته کوچک نگه داشته شده است. 90 درصد بقیه به زبان Maple نوشته شده است که در کتابخانه های Maple قرار دارد.
این نرمافزار در تمام زمینههای ریاضی از جمله:
- جبر خطی
- ریاضیات گسسته
- حسابان
- محاسبات علمی
- فیزیک محاسباتی
- جبر خطی عددی
- دینامیک محاسباتی سیالات
- مشتقگیری عددی
- انتگرالگیری عددی
- رسم نمودار های اعم از متحرک و ثابت
- و ...
حتی ریاضیات مقدماتی برای دانشآموزان دبیرستانی میتواند مفید واقع شود.
امکانات و ویژگیهای نرمافزار Maple :
- رابط گرافیکی و پیشرفتهی نرمافزار با کاربری سریع
- امکان انجام بیش از 5000 عملیات و توابع مختلف
- انجام محاسبات جبری و منطقی، محاسبات هندسی و…
- حل مسائل فیزیک محاسباتی مانند مکانیک کلاسیک، فیزیک کوانتوم و نظریه میدان نسبیتی
- رسم نمودارهای مختلف توابع بهشکل ثابت و متحرک
- برخورداری از کتابخانهی گستردهی انواع توابع و عملیات
- مدلسازی پیشرفتهی مالی
- ارتباط و هماهنگی با نرمافزارهای مختلف مانند MATLAB، برنامههای طراحی CAD، پایگاههای داده و غیره
- و…
"یک نگاره ایجاد شده با نرم افزار maple"
طرز کار میپل
کاربران میتوانند ریاضیات را با علائم تجاری در آن وارد کنند. واسط کاربری نیز میتواند توسط کاربر درست شود. میپل یک زبان برنامهنویسی مرکب از زبانهای دستوری و زبانهای پویا است. همچنین واسطهایی برای کار با دیگر زبانها مثل C ,Fortran,Java,Matlab,Visual Basic وجود دارند.
چند مثال :
انتگرال:
int(cos(x/a), x);
دستور فوق انتگرال(cos(x/aرا بر حسب متغیر x میگیرد.
رسم نمودار سه بعدی:
(plot3d(x^2+y^2,x=-1..1,y=-۱..۱;
دستور فوق نمودار تابع x^2+y^2 را بر حسب دو متغیر x و y در بازه [-۱٬۱] برای آنها رسم مینماید.
نکته: در maple دستورات با حروف کوچک نوشته میشود و بین حروف کوچک و بزرگ تفاوت وجود دارد.
آموزش
دانلود مقاله آموزش maple : زبان فارسی ، تعداد صفحات 37
راهنمای نصب
1- پیشنیازهای نرمافزاری و سختافزاری برنامهها و افزونهها را در اینجا ببینید.
2- دانلود Maplesoft Maple 2018.0 نسخه لینوکس :
دانلود Maplesoft Maple 2018.0 برای سایر سیستم عامل ها
3- اجرای فایل run. برنامه
64-bit Linux Single User Installation
During the installation, you will need your purchase code, generally sent to you in an email.
To install Maple 18 on your 64-bit Linux operating system, read and complete the following tasks.
INTRODUCTION
Pre-Installation Instructions
- Check the System Requirements for your operating system.
- Log on as an administrator or log on to an account, with appropriate read and write privileges, that will own the Maple files.
- Ensure that you are connected to the Internet. If your computer does not have an Internet connection, please contact your distributor or Maplesoft customer service.
- Check your video card driver requirements. For more information, see Verifying Video Card Driver Requirements.
- Close all programs.
- Ensure that you have reviewed the Pre-installation Instructions.
- Choose one of the following two options to launch the installer:
- From DVD
- Place the install disc in the DVD-ROM drive.
- Locate and run Maple2017.0LinuxX64Installer.run from the install disc.
- From download
Run Maple2017.0LinuxX64Installer.run from where you downloaded the file.
- Follow the on-screen instructions.
Note: If you have MATLAB® 2016a, 2016b, or 2017a installed and would like to install a toolbox that connects Maple with MATLAB®, see Maple Toolbox Installation.
- In the Choose The Type of Licensing screen, select Single User License .
- When prompted, enter the purchase code and the required information to complete activation.
- If you activated successfully, you are ready to use Maple 2017. If you had problems activating or chose not to activate during the installation, see Activating Single User Versions.